Job Title: Board Certified Behavior Analyst

We are seeking a highly skilled and dedicated Board Certified Behavior Analyst to join our team at Ascend Autism Group.

About the Role:

  • Conduct comprehensive assessments and develop personalized treatment plans for clients with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D)
  • Lead and supervise a team of Behavior Technicians and Registered Behavior Technicians (RBTs) to ensure high-quality care and services
  • Collaborate with families and caregivers to implement treatment plans and provide ongoing support
  • Develop and maintain accurate and organized patient records, data, and reports
  • Participate in team meetings and training workshops to stay up-to-date on best practices and industry developments

What We Offer:

  • A competitive salary range of $70,000 - $80,000 with quarterly bonus opportunities
  • A comprehensive benefits package, including health insurance and 401(k) matching
  • Generous paid time off and opportunities for professional development and growth
  • A rewarding and challenging work environment with a team of dedicated professionals

Requirements:

  • Board Certification in Behavior Analysis (BCBA) and applicable state licensure
  • Experience working with children with ASD and developing ABA programs
  • Excellent communication and administrative skills
  • Ability to work collaboratively with families and caregivers

Ascend Autism Group is an Equal Opportunity Employer.
